Permanent vs. Temporary Residency

Choosing permanent residency means you can stay in Costa Rica without yearly checks. You’re free to live, work, and invest. Temporary options, like Pensionado and Rentista, lead to permanency. But, you need to show you still have income or investments.

Eligibility Requirements for Permanent Residency

Getting permanent residency might need investing, retiring, or joining family in Costa Rica. Projects have different demands but all may need stable monthly income or a big investment. Knowing these rules early can make your move smoother.

Residency Program Minimum Requirements
Pensionado (Retirement) $1,000 per month from a guaranteed pension
Rentista (Unearned Income) $2,500 per month in unearned income for at least 2 years
Inversionista (Investment) $150,000 investment in tangible property, shares, or national interest projects

Access to Healthcare and Social Services

When you become a permanent resident in Costa Rica, you and your loved ones get access to the Caja, the country’s health and security system. This means you all can enjoy quality medical care. It also covers pre-existing health conditions. Plus, it opens doors to the country’s social welfare programs.

Getting permanent residency in Costa Rica is not hard. It’s a key step for expats and those who want to live in Costa Rica long-term. You need at least three years as a temporary resident. And it’s easier with help from the pros at Costa Rica Immigration Experts (CRIE).

When you start, you get a “Hoja trámite.” This lets you stay in Costa Rica legally while you apply. You won’t have to leave every 180 days. If you need more time to gather your documents, you can extend for $100 USD within the 180-day period.

Required Documents and Translations

As you start, you’ll need various papers. This includes a Criminal Record Check and documents for family. Documents from outside Costa Rica need extra steps. They must either have an Apostille or be legalized by the Costa Rican Consulate.

Also, all non-Spanish papers need to turn into Spanish. An Official Translator must do this. They should be registered with Costa Rica’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s.

Apostille and Document Authentication

Getting an Apostille is key. It proves your documents are real. If your papers come from another country, they must get an Apostille or Costa Rican Consulate’s approval.
